Overview of Omega and Casio

Omega is a Swiss luxury watchmaker known for its precision and craftsmanship. Founded in 1848, the brand has a long history of creating high-quality timepieces, including the iconic Speedmaster, which was the first watch worn on the moon. Omega watches are often associated with elegance, sophistication, and durability, catering to those looking for luxury and status.

Casio, on the other hand, is a Japanese electronics company that has made a name for itself in the watch industry with its innovative and affordable timepieces. Established in 1946, Casio is well-known for its digital watches, including the famous G-Shock series, which is celebrated for its toughness and functionality. Casio watches appeal to a broader audience, particularly those who value practicality and technology over luxury.

User Experience: Omega Watches

Quality and Craftsmanship

Users frequently praise Omega watches for their exceptional quality and craftsmanship. Many reviews highlight the intricate details and precision of the movements, which contribute to the overall luxury feel of the watch. Customers often report that their Omega timepieces not only look stunning but also perform reliably over time.

Style and Design

Omega watches are often described as elegant and timeless. Users appreciate the variety of styles available, from classic dress watches to sporty models. The brand's attention to design details, such as the choice of materials and finishes, is a common point of praise. Many users feel that wearing an Omega watch elevates their style and makes a statement.

Customer Service and Warranty

Several users have noted positive experiences with Omega's customer service. The brand offers a comprehensive warranty and repair service, which gives buyers peace of mind. Customers have reported that the process for servicing their watches is straightforward and efficient, further enhancing their overall satisfaction with the brand.

User Experience: Casio Watches

Affordability and Value

One of the most significant advantages of Casio watches is their affordability. Users often mention that they can purchase a reliable and functional watch without breaking the bank. Many customers feel that Casio provides excellent value for money, especially considering the range of features included in their watches.

Durability and Functionality

Casio watches, particularly the G-Shock series, are renowned for their durability. Users frequently highlight the ruggedness of these watches, making them ideal for outdoor activities and sports. Many reviews mention that their Casio watches have survived drops, water exposure, and extreme temperatures without any issues.

Variety and Features

Casio offers a wide variety of watches that cater to different needs and preferences. Users appreciate the range of features available, such as alarms, timers, and even Bluetooth connectivity in some models. Many customers enjoy the practicality of having multiple functions in one watch, making Casio a popular choice for those who lead active lifestyles.

Comparing User Experiences

Price Point

One of the most significant differences between Omega and Casio watches is the price point. Omega watches typically fall into the luxury category, with prices ranging from several thousand to tens of thousands of dollars. In contrast, Casio watches are generally much more affordable, with many models available for under $100. This price discrepancy often influences buyers' decisions based on their budget and preferences.

Target Audience

The target audience for each brand is another factor that sets them apart. Omega appeals to consumers looking for luxury, status, and craftsmanship, while Casio targets a broader audience that values functionality, durability, and affordability. Users often choose based on their lifestyle needs and personal preferences.

Brand Reputation

Both brands have established solid reputations in the watch industry, but for different reasons. Omega is often seen as a symbol of luxury and prestige, while Casio is viewed as a practical and reliable choice. User reviews reflect these perceptions, with many highlighting the brand's identity in their purchasing decisions.
